The Schwab U.S. Dividend Equity ETF (SCHD) pays qualified dividends that are taxed favorably in taxable accounts but still incur annual federal taxes, costing investors around $2,625 yearly on a $500,000 portfolio at the 24% tax bracket. Holding SCHD in a Roth IRA eliminates this tax drag, allowing dividends to be reinvested tax-free and growing tax-free over time. Over 10 to 20 years, this tax advantage can preserve tens of thousands of dollars in income and appreciation. Investors should consider prioritizing SCHD shares in Roth accounts to maximize tax efficiency and evaluate Roth conversions based on their specific dividend tax costs.
